July 2, 2009
DHCD Releases Survey for Development of Five-Year Consolidated Plan

(Washington, D.C.) - The Department of Housing and Community Development (DHCD) is beginning the development process for its Five-Year Consolidated Plan for Fiscal Years 2011-2015. 

The Five-Year Consolidated Plan identifies policies and strategies to address the housing and community development needs of low to moderate income residents using the following federal entitlement grants - Community Development Block Grant (C DBG); HOME Investment Partnerships Program (HOME); Emergency Shelter Grant Program (ESG); and Housing Opportunities for Persons with AIDS Program (HOPWA).

As part of the development process, DHCD has created a public survey to help determine budget and program priorities for the upcoming five-year period.  The survey is available until August 31, 2009.

DHCD will also hold a series of hearings for public comments on the plan later this year.
